Abstract

A novel approach of directly writing permanent 2-D holographic gratings on pure liquid crystalline structures fabricated with well established alignment surfaces is introduced. By performing theoretical analysis, it is shown that such structures exhibit tubable bandgap, and will also enable super-prism beam steering effects.
